In a pumped storage plant, water is pumped from a lower reservoir to a higher reservoir during off-peak times when electricity is relatively cheap, using electricity generated from other types of energy sources. The ability to ramp up and down hydropower generation is a valuable source of flexible generation on the electricity grid, which can directly displace coal and natural gas, and help integrate larger amounts of variable renewable energy resources, like wind and solar power. Hydropower re-licensing processes across the country have resulted in increased flows to support aquatic and riparian habitats, better access and services to support public recreation on rivers, and protection of cultural heritage sites [10].
